Angry Gérard Piqué throws bank statement of his wages online after fuss about salary

In Spain a fuss has arisen about the wages of FC Barcelona players. The Spanish top club has been struggling with financial problems for several years, but is still said to pay its players excessive salaries. Defender Gerard Pique was fed up and threw his payslip on the internet.

It was the Spanish journalist Lluís Canut of Mundo Deportivo who rang the bell on Thursday. He claimed on the Catalan public broadcaster TV3 that he knew how much the Barcelona players earned annually: Gérard Piqué (28 million euros gross), Sergio Busquets (23 million euros), Jordi Alba and Samuel Umtiti (20 million euros), Marc- André ter Stegen (14 million euros), Ousmane Dembélé and Sergi Roberto (12 million euros).

Big earner Piqué reacted very angrily on Friday evening and promptly threw his December 30 bank statement on his social media. It reads the amount of “2,328,884.39 euros – salary”. “People like this who are paid by the public broadcaster to defend their friends… Here you have 50% of my salary, received on December 30th. Respect yourself a little bit,” Piqué wrote.

2.3 million euros net, so 4.6 million euros net in total. Because the Barcelona players get their wages paid every six months. A hefty amount, but far from the 28 million euros gross that Lluís Canut had thrown on the table. Barcelona had previously denied the Spanish journalist’s coverage.
